Jh Carne En Vara a La Llanera #1 has been inspected three times since 2023. On Sep 21, 2024, the health department conducted the most recent visit. A high risk rating points to multiple serious findings at the most recent inspection.

Things have been moving the wrong way, with the rolling count rising from around six violations to closer to 20 violations per visit.

The most common issue across all inspections has been “no chlorine chemical test kit provided”, showing up two times.

Compared to other Miami restaurants (averaging 74), there's room to close the gap. The pattern in the record is worth a careful look.
